HITMAN HITS MOBILE DEVICES

Today sees the launch of Hitman GO, a simple to play, but difficult to master puzzle game set in a stunning interpretation of the Hitman universe. The talented team at Square Enix Montréal has created a new and unique experience for iOS devices priced at $4.99 and can be found on iTunes here.

Hitman GO takes aspects of the Hitman universe to create a brand new and distinctive mobile gaming experience. This beautifully rendered diorama-style turn-based puzzle game focuses on forward thinking to progress through challenging levels and stylish freeze frame environments, to challenge even the most accomplished Hitman fan.

“We wanted to make something unexpected. Something that crystalizes everything ‘Hitman’ in the simplest way possible, while retaining the high class, cool attitude the famous assassin is known for,” said Karsten Lund, Creative Director at Square Enix Montréal. “You have to consider your every move in order to solve the puzzles. It’s about being undercover, smart and stealthy. We boiled most of the core Hitman mechanics such as disguises, distractions and different weapons, down to the simplest possible game, without losing the fun and tension of its AAA counterpart.”

About Hitman GO
Developed by Square Enix Montréal, Hitman GO is a turn-based puzzle game with beautifully rendered diorama-style set pieces. You will strategically navigate fixed spaces on a grid to avoid enemies and take out your target or infiltrate well-guarded locations. You really have to think about each move and all the Hitman tools of the trade you would expect are included; disguises distractions, sniper rifles and even 47’s iconic Silverballers.
